Last year, more than 3,500 middle and high school students nationwide have learned first hand that improving the environment is within their control and real change can take place -- one step at a time. These students participated in the Lexus Environmental Challenge, a program designed by Lexus and Scholastic to educate teens about the environment and empower them to create a better world. 120 of my students created 20 amazing projects. Six of these went on to win regional awards, and three teams won First Place nationwide.
